Responsibilities
- Patrol designated areas to prevent crime and ensure public safety
- Respond to emergency calls and incidents requiring law enforcement intervention
- Conduct preliminary investigations and document incident reports
- Collaborate with community organizations to build trust and partnerships
- Enforce federal, state, and local laws with impartiality
- Provide first aid and crisis intervention during emergencies
- Maintain accurate records and submit required documentation
Qualifications
- U.S. citizenship and valid California driver's license
- High school diploma or GED; college degree preferred
- Minimum 21 years of age
- Successful completion of background investigation and polygraph
- Completion of POST-certified basic academy training
- Ability to obtain and maintain firearm certification
- Strong communication skills and conflict resolution abilities
- Physical fitness to meet departmental standards
